## Section 1: Understanding United Airlines' Flight Change Policies
Before diving into the process of changing your flight, it’s essential to understand United Airlines’ change policies. United Airlines allows passengers to change their flights, but the rules can vary depending on the fare class and the timing of the change. Generally, passengers can make changes to their itinerary without incurring fees if they are on flexible tickets. However, basic economy tickets often have stricter regulations and potential fees.
### Key Points to Remember:
- **Ticket Type Matters**: Check if you have a basic economy, standard, or flexible fare.
- **Change Fees**: Be aware of potential fees associated with changing flights.
- **Travel Dates**: Changes made well in advance may incur lower fees.
- **Difference in Fare**: If the new flight is more expensive, you may need to pay the fare difference.
## Section 2: Step-by-Step Process to Change Your United Airlines Flight
Changing your flight with United Airlines is a straightforward process. Here’s how to do it step-by-step:
### Step 1: Visit the United Airlines Website
- Go to the [United Airlines homepage](https://www.united.com).
### Step 2: Access Your Itinerary
- Click on the “My Trips” section located at the top of the page.
- Enter your last name and confirmation number to access your itinerary.
### Step 3: Select the Flight You Wish to Change
- Once you’re in your itinerary, locate the flight you desire to change.
- Click on "Change Flight" or “Modify Flight” option next to your selected flight.
### Step 4: Choose Your New Flight
- Browse the available flights based on your preferences.
- Review the departure times, arrival times, and any additional fees before selecting your new flight.
### Step 5: Confirm Changes
- After selecting your new flight, click "Next".
- Review any fee changes or fare differences.
- Add any additional services if needed.
### Step 6: Payment (if applicable)
- If your new flight incurs a fee, be ready to provide payment information before confirming the change.
### Step 7: Receive Confirmation
- Once everything is finalized, you will receive a confirmation email with all details regarding your new flight.
## Section 3: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. **How much does it cost to change a United Airlines flight?**
- Change fees vary depending on your ticket type. Basic economy tickets generally have the highest fees or may not be eligible for changes without a fee.
2. **Can I change my flight for free?**
- If you have a flexible fare or if your flight is significantly delayed or canceled, you may be able to change without incurring a fee.
3. **Can I change my flight on the United Airlines mobile app?**
- Yes, you can change your flight using the United Airlines mobile app. Simply log in to your account and navigate to your trips.
4. **What if I need to change my flight due to an emergency?**
- In emergencies, contacting United Airlines directly through their customer service may lead to special accommodations.
5. **How far in advance can I change my United Airlines flight?**
- Typically, you can change your flight up to a few hours before departure, but it’s best to do so as early as possible.
